Off the Chain is a low cost, volunteer run bicycle cooperative open to the Anchorage community. Off the Chain strives to increase bicycle ridership, awareness, and safety through community service and education. |
Off the Chain Bicycle Collective is a low cost, volunteer run, bicycle collective open to the Anchorage community. Our primary purpose is to foster a safe, educational and diverse environment that emphasizes pedal powered transportation.
